On the Sonoma coast, lamb is shaped by grass, weather, animal maturity and the discipline of buying the whole share. Bodega Pastures keeps that pastoral timing visible, turning coastal sheep husbandry into a freezer-ready food source with place and season intact.

Its care shows in pasture raising, share-based ordering, cut separation and frozen custody, preserving the moment when one animal can become roasts, chops, braises, bones and stock with clean lamb flavor and coastal depth.

Whole Grass-Fed Lamb Share

Whole Grass-Fed Lamb Share turns coastal Sonoma pasture into a complete kitchen supply. Chops, roasts, braising cuts, bones and trim each carry the same source, giving the buyer clean lamb flavor, freezer range and the practical reward of using the full animal.
